LASIK is an efficient treatment to deal with nearsightedness, farsightedness and also astigmatism. Normally, individuals between the ages of 20 and also 40 are optimal candidates for LASIK.
The treatment completely changes the form of your cornea, which enhances vision so you can see clearly without depending on contact lenses or glasses. It is very important to select a certified eye surgeon.

4. Prep work
Your medical professional will certainly do a series of tests to make sure that you are an excellent prospect for LASIK. These examinations look for your eye health and wellness, ensure that your prescription hasn't changed a lot over the in 2014 and examine whether you have conditions that might interfere with the surgery.
On the day of your surgery, do not use make-up as well as stay clear of perfumes or creams. These can hinder the medicines and also laser utilized throughout the treatment.
Also, make certain to prepare for a person to drive you home after your therapy. You will be too dazed to drive safely afterward.

6. Healing
Many patients recover quickly from LASIK. They might experience blurry vision for a day or 2 as their eyes heal, but they ought to be able to do everyday activities after this time period.
Your eyes may itch, really feel sandy, as well as watery after surgical procedure.
